List of delights

- Eating peanut butter & celery, which I only seem to make every 4 years; recognizing, yet again, what a fabulous treat this is; committing, yet again, to snacking on it more often
- A friend recommending this podcast and me excitedly anticipating learning the "history and strategy" of Trader Joe's, one of my favorite places to shop
- Eating a piping hot bowl of pho with freshly torn basil and a big squeeze of lime, creating just the right pep to balance out the rich broth and endless tangle of noodles
- Ordering the PERFECT gift for someone - wait, not just ordering it, but ordering it on time, and it arriving on time, and packing it up the night before, ready to surprise a friend defending her dissertation *today*
- Scheduling a call with one of my daughter's friends, a brilliant, reflective human who is thinking through a big decision and wants to connect; feeling the honor of being in this young person's life
- Having gas in the car when you're starting a road trip, so heading right to the highway (with your Trader Joe's podcast playing and a tupperware filled with celery sticks & peanut butter)
